In a mixture of 4.5 ml of ethanol and 4.5 ml of N,N-dimethylformamide was dissolved 400 mg of anhydrous piperazine, and 450 mg of ethyl 7-azido-1-(2,4-difluorophenyl)-6-fluoro-1,4-dihydro-4-oxo-1,8-naphthyridine-3-carboxylate was added to the resulting solution, after which the resulting mixture was subjected to reaction at 80° C. for 1 hour. The solvent was removed by distillation under reduced pressure, and to the residue thus obtained were added 30 ml of ethyl acetate and 30 ml of water, after which the pH thereof was adjusted to 1.0 with 2N hydrochloric acid. The aqueous layer was separated, and 15 ml of chloroform was added to the aqueous layer, after which the pH thereof was adjusted to 8.5 with 1N aqueous sodium hydroxide solution. The organic layer was separated, washed successively with 10 ml of water and 10 ml of saturated aqueous sodium chloride solution, and then dried over anhydrous magnesium sulfate. The solvent was removed by distillation under reduced pressure, and to the residue thus obtained was added 5 ml of diethyl ether, after which the crystals thus deposited were collected by filtration to obtain 420 mg (yield 84.0%) of ethyl 1-(2,4-difluorophenyl)-6-fluoro-1,4-dihydro-4-oxo-7-(1-piperazinyl)-1,8-naphthyridine-3-carboxylate. The physical properties of this compound were identical with those of the compound obtained in Example 65.
